Kerala Kings win inaugural T10 League title

SHARJAH (Dunya News) - Kerala Kings captain Eoin Morgan led his side from the front to beat Punjabi Legends by eight wickets with two overs to spare in the final to win the inaugural T10 Cricket League crown at the Sharjah Cricket Stadium on Sunday.

Kerala Kings won the toss and elected to field first. Batting first, Punjabi Legends scored 120 runs for the loss of three wickets with the help of an 83-run partnership between Luke Ronchi and Shoaib Malik.

Luke Ronchi scored 70 runs in 34 balls with five fours and five sixes while Shoaib Malik contributed 26 runs in 14 balls with one four and two towering sixes. Rayad Emrit and Plunkett got one wicket each for the Kerala Kings.

In reply, Kerala Kings reached the target for the loss of only two wickets with two overs to spare. Kerala captain Eoin Morgan played a swashbuckling knock of 63 runs studded with five fours and six sixes in just 21 balls.

Morgan shared a 113-run second wicket stand with Paul Stirling who remained not out after scoring 52 runs with the help of three 4s and five 6s in just 23 ball. Faheem Ashraf and Hassan Ali claimed one wicket apiece for Punjabi Legends.
